A short bar magnet is placed in the magnetic meridian of the earth with North Pole pointing north. Neutral points are found at a distance of 30 cm from the magnet on the East-West line, drawn through the middle point of the magnet. The magnetic moment of the magnet in Am 2 is close to: (Given μ 0 4 π = 10 - 7 in SI units and B H = Horizontal component of earth's magnetic field = 3.6 × 10 - 5 Tesla.
Options
- A4.9
- B14.6
- C19.4
- D9.7
Correct answer
D. 9.7
Step-by-step solution
Horizontal component of earth's magnetic field is along geographical south its North. M → = Magnetic dipole moment. At neutral point on the equatorial line the magnetic field B ′ cancels B H ∴ B ′ = B H ⇒ μ 0 4 π M x 3 = B H   ⇒ 10 - 7 × M 30 100 3 = 3.6 × 10 - 5 ⇒ 10 - 7 × 10 3 × M 27 = 3.6 × 10 - 5 M = 27 × 3.6 × 10 - 5 10 - 4 M = 27 × 3.6 × 10 - 1 = 9.72 M ≈ 9.7
